The value of "02" in SIG: indicates a 2-digit year, such as "87". A value of "04" would mean a 4-digit year, such as "1987". Similar edits are provided for EDIT TYPE "D" and "Y".
The value of "00" in DEC: indicates that any valid year will be accepted.
As a default, MAGEC will automatically reformat dates into YYMMDD (or CCYYMMDD) as they are moved to the database.
MAGEC also handles leap-year and centesimal editing.
